Are you using an ATI card? If so, ever since the latest patch updates I have to go into advance settings and choose the first video setting that has HAL in the description. Ever since then I haven't crashed at all Maybe that's the issue? Even if it's not ATI, maybe it's worth a shot? Mine would be playing just fine and then poof it would just disappear, not like "ao is now closing... *blue bar going across the screen*".. this was just *poof.. gone* Ever since the HAL change, it's been flawless.
